Located in the South of France, the Arène de Nîmes come straight from Roman times.
Tap to explore
Tap to explore
Tap to explore
Credits: All media
The story featured may in some cases have been created by an independent third party and may not always represent the views of the institutions, listed below, who have supplied the content.